Rolex calls their brand ambassadors Testimonees. They really look for the best of the best across industries, sports, professions, and more. Is it any wonder they sought out Chuck Yeager for the role? Chuck Yeager was a US Air Force test pilot who was the first person to break the sound barrier. He was also the first person to fly more than twice the speed of sound. 

On October 14, 1947, Yeager flew the Bell X-1 aircraft faster than the speed of sound. This was a major breakthrough that disproved the idea that aircraft couldn't fly faster than sound. In 1953, Yeager flew the Bell X-lA more than twice the speed of sound. Yeager was known for his willingness to work hard and outlearn others. Yeager was a World War II fighter ace and received the Congressional Medal of Honor. He also trained Gemini, Mercury, and Apollo astronauts.

Yeager became a brigadier general in the United States Air Force on August 1, 1969, with a date of rank of June 22, 1969. Yeager was promoted to brigadier general after serving as a colonel in the Air Force. Yeager was inducted into the National Aviation Hall of Fame in 1973. He retired from military service in 1975 with the rank of brigadier general. 

Is it any wonder that Rolex wanted him?

When Yeager broke the sound barrier, he did it while wearing a Rolex. He was such a fan of his Rolex that he sent Hans Wilsdorf, the founder of Rolex, an autographed photo of the Bell X-1 (the test plane he piloted) and himself. It was years later, in the early 2000s that he became a brand ambassador, appearing in advertisements for the Rolex GMT Master II and the GMT Master Oyster Thunderbird.
